Best VPN service for Myanmar

Important: In 2021, Myanmar’s military ousted the democratically elected government and immediately banned VPN use. However, with arbitrary arrests and state-sponsored violence becoming more prevalent in the aftermath of the coup, it is more critical than ever to maintain open communication with people outside the nation. Nonetheless, we recommend that readers evaluate the possible repercussions carefully before using a VPN in Myanmar.

Myanmar’s internet has been assigned a resounding “not-free” classification by advocacy group Freedom House. This is primarily because the army closely tracks what people say and do online, shuts off internet connections when demonstrations get too big to manage, and ruthlessly punishes individuals who express divergent views.

1. HideMyAss

HideMyAss (HMA), situated in the United Kingdom, has been accused of turning over user data to law enforcement authorities on at least two consecutive instances.

In 2011, it was revealed that the business aided the FBI in its investigation into the Sony Pictures breach. The US law enforcement agency was reportedly aided by HMA in identifying and apprehending suspect Cody Kretsinger. The aspiring hacker attempted to conceal his traces throughout the assault by using HMA. What made problems worse was that, at the time, HMA had an official ‘no-logs’ policy.

HideMyAss was also responsible for the arrest of former US district judge Chris Dupuy. The judge was accused of portraying two women as call girls and trying to maintain his anonymity through the use of HMA. After the two ladies complained, law enforcement authorities intervened. Once they suspected the usage of a VPN, they followed the steps back to HMA, which completed the investigation.

2. HolaVPN

Israel-based Hola unlawfully monetized its almost 50 million user base by establishing a large botnet. The bandwidth of users was sabotaged to conduct Distributed Denial of Service attacks, promote illegal content, and participate in pornography.

The Methodology: Choosing the best Myanmar VPN

Myanmar’s internet is closely regulated, and the government watches everything you do online. As a result, we’ve prioritized VPNs that go above and beyond to protect your identity, as well as those that are capable of circumventing country-wide internet censorship. This is precisely what we searched for while suggesting the best VPN for Myanmar:

  • Security tools: We demand almost unbreakable encryption (256-bit AES or higher), as well as security against DNS, IPv6, and WebRTC leaks, as well as a kill switch. Support for newer protocols such as WireGuard would be ideal, since they are quicker, simpler to audit, and less likely to have significant undetected vulnerabilities.
  • Privacy-enhancing features: A critical factor is to ensure that your VPN maintains a no-logs policy. However, we appreciate those that have anti-tracking capabilities and allow you to sign up anonymously using cryptocurrencies.
  • Unblocking capabilities: A stealth mode is required since it enables you to circumvent the country’s internet censorship and access services like Skype, Facebook, and Twitter, even if the military bans them again.
  • Speed and dependability: It is insufficient to have a VPN that operates intermittently. We’ve only picked the quickest, most reliable providers to ensure that your security is never jeopardized.

FAQs on browsing safely in Myanmar

Is it possible to use a free VPN in Myanmar?

While there are several free VPNs available, they often provide an incredibly rudimentary service with inadequate encryption specifications. Given the present state of Myanmar, it would be incredibly unwise to entrust your well-being to a corporation that believes the bare minimum is acceptable.

Is it possible to unblock Facebook in Myanmar using a VPN?

Although Facebook was only temporarily disabled, if the military blocks access again, a VPN will enable you to access it anyway. You may want to consider moving to a different communication network, such as Signal or Telegram, solely because Facebook gathers so much personally identifiable information about its users.
